Katsaris plays Chopin

Piano21 P21 043N

I have received this new Chopin recital recently, having interviewed Cyprian Katsaris not long ago and reviewed his "own label" series extensively.

This latest is compiled judiciously from a number of live recitals 1978-2010, with the opportunity to hear Katsaris play Yamaha CFX & CFIIIS and Steinway C & D instruments in various German locations, in Chigasaki & Tokyo and in Paris, where he lives.

The whole is beautifully put together as a seamless recital of Chopin favourites and interesting rarities, finishing with a magical account of the slow movement of the Concerto No 2 in Chopin's own arrangement for solo piano.

Treasurable and unreservedly recommended; we really cannot afford to not have Cyprian Katsaris invited regularly to play in England, which he would welcome...

The production is excellent, with every piece and its performance carefully documented, and the above cover photo; every reader but myself will recognise Karl Lagerfeld, I am assured...
